Finishes
Select from three different grades of finish that would best suit your gun. All finishes include both stock and forend wood.

Bronze
£180.00
3-4 week completion time
A bronze grade re-finish is a great way to add a light layer of protection to your gun. A Bronze grade service will consist of the following;
- Light cut back of original finish
- No dents or scratches removed
- Alkanet root oil applied-Hand burnish between coats using rotten stone
- Coats of SS Traditional English oil finish
Silver
£300.00
4-5 week completion time
A silver grade re-finish is the most cost effective way to have a full finish. A Silver grade oil finish will consist of the following;
- Full cut back of original finish
- All dents or scratches removed
- Alkanet root oil applied
- Hand burnish between coats using rotten stone
- 15 coats of SS Traditional English oil finish
Gold
£450.00
5-6 week completion time
A gold grade re-finish is the highest level of oil finish. Often referred to as a "Best oil finish". A gold grade oil finish will consist of the following;
- Full cut back of original finish
- All dents or scratches removed
- Alkanet root oil applied
- Hand burnish between coats using rotten stone
- 25 to 30 coats of SS Traditional English oil finish
- All grain filled & sealed to achieve glass-hard finish.
